OK, some of this depends on the time of year. You can ride every attraction in the park in a day easily... and this isn't from lack of rides, it's just a really well run park and the crowds are not overwhelming most days (opening weekend, holiday weekends and Christmas season are exceptions). Plan to get there a little before opening, and when the park opens you'll be able to ride whatever you want. Most rides don't typically have more than a 30 minute wait, and if one does, just wait til later in the day. The Dollywood app will be your friend to check back on wait times. Lightning Rod typically commands the longest waits, so if it has a short time when you arrive, turn to the right when you enter the park. Otherwise choose whichever direction looks less crowded. Most of the newer attractions, including this one opening soon will be to the left FYI.
Also to note, the Dollywood resorts are gorgeous, but there are other very lovely well run hotels in the area, some with river views that are extremely affordable.
